It is very important to periodically period your actors iron food preparation grids. This will certainly protect against food from sticking, protect against rusting as well as increase the life of your.

grids for several years to come. Seasoning your actors iron grids fasts as well as simple. Follow these simple steps: With the cover open, transform on your bbq grill and also set the control handles to the tool HIGH placement. After twenty minutes, transform the control handles to the off position and also wait a couple of mins to cool.( around 300F) Spread out a thin finishing of cooking oil over whole surface of the actors iron grids with a basting brush or oil mister. Be particular the whole surface area, including all corners, have actually been coated extensively. KEEP IN MIND: We recommend you use veggie, olive, canola, sunflower oil or vegetable shortening. DO NOT utilize salty fat such as margarine or butter. They burn off at a truly low warm and will certainly not protect the grids.

After a brand-new hot plate is bought, it is necessary to season it for the initial time. Food can stick, the hot plate itself may corrosion,as well as you might have to purchase a brand-new one altogether. A cast iron plate is a long-lasting financial investment, but it needs upkeep to stay lovely. A little bit of oil regularly will certainly make home plate last longer as well as will stop rusting. Tidy hot plates are vital for your very first food preparation session. The majority of brand names supply tidy hotplates, but you need to still offer it a clean before cooking to eliminate any chemicals that might have been used throughout the cooking process. The excellent barbeque plate is the most effective device for cooking food to outright excellence. If you're aiming to save effort and time in the future, all you require is a little seasoning applied at the start. Before you start cooking, you require to get your BBQ prepared. Cleansing is the most crucial action. You'll need a sponge and a paper towel. The 2nd step is pre-heating the grill or hotplate. To clean up the new hot plate, you require to make use of warm water and a sponge. Add a tiny amount of soap. The cleaning process need to not be elaborate. If you over-clean the hotplate, it will certainly shed its glossiness as well as become dull. Wash your BBQ grill with water and also ensure it's entirely dry before applying oil. The kind of oil you make use of can straight influence the seasoning process. It is best to use a fluid oil thathas a heat threshold. It is necessary to use a percentage of oil equally. If it is as well a lot, a paper towel can be utilized to absorb the excess. Warm your grill to regarding 180C, and also prepare it for 30 mins with the lid open.
